Aide - Recherche - Membres - Calendrier
Version complète : Vhcs -> Sécurisé Ou Non ?
La Communauté TitaXium > Service Communication > Espace Developpement > Hébergements
Xinox
Bonjour à tous,

D'ici quelques temps je vais mettre en place un serveur en place :wub: .

Je voulais m'orienter vers VHCS, et on m'a dit que ça ne l'était pas.

Alors, qu'en est-il réellement de ce tableau de bord ?

Je vous remercie.
Xtouch
Ouais ouais VHCS c'est très bien.

Je m'y suis pas mal intéressé à une certaine époque, et c'est pas mal du tout. C''est certes pas aussi complet qu'un Plesk par exemple, mais je trouve ça déjà très bien.

Je ne lui connait personnellement pas de réputation de boulet au niveau de la sécurité. C'est de toutes façons à mon goût un des outils gratuits les mieux adaptés pour faire ce que tu vas faire.

Edit : non en fait, rien ne vaut mieux qu'un panel d'administration développé à la main et réellement adapté à tes besoins wink.gif
Xinox
Citation (Xtouch @ jeudi 04 janvier 2007 à 13h54) *
Edit : non en fait, rien ne vaut mieux qu'un panel d'administration développé à la main et réellement adapté à tes besoins wink.gif


Oui je sais, c'est ce je prévois de faire, mais faut démarrer sur quelque chose en attendant d'avoir une équipe solide pour se lancer dans ce genre de projet.

Merci en tout cas, je vais étudier ça.

D'autres avis ?

HS : au fait y'a toujours pas moyen de te parler via Yahoo Messenger Xtouch ?
Xtouch
Regarde aussi quand même du côté de AlternC.
Une fois personnalisé, ça peut être bien puissant.

HS : dans mon école, Yahoo ne passe pas. J'attends une connexion Free. Par contre, je suis en vacances jusqu'à dimanche, donc je suis sur yahoo là wink.gif
Florian_
VHCS est sécurisé étant donné que beaucoup de monde utilise ce panel de gestion mais il y a un petit "hic" il n'a pas été mis à jour depuis un certain moment je crois que le projet est abandonné par le créateur mais comme dit Xtouch rien ne vaut un bon panel codé soit même, ce n'est pas très compliqué si tu as des bases en PHP par exemple si ton serveur ftp stock les comptes dans un fichier text il fwrite suffira avec la structure du fichier, sinon une insertion SQL du compte bref ce n'est qu'un exemple je développe moi même actuellement mon propre panel !

A bientôt !
Méthylbro
N'hésites pas à venir nous montrer tes sources Florian smile.gif

je suis curieux de voir à quoi peut ressembler un machin de ce genre.
Nokilling
Ah, sa me rappelle mon projet de troisième semestre à mon école smile.gif

Pour les sources, je vais essayer de voir si j'ai encore mes scripts shell, car les sources php je suis sur de plus les avoir :s

Dans mon cas, les connaissances php était plutot secondaire, car le php servait surtout pour faire des exec, et faire l'administration des utilisateurs avec une base de données.
Mais il faut quand même les bases du SHELL, car quand tu dois ajouter un utilisateurs avec MySecureShell, si on connais pas les bases, c'est pas facile à faire :s

Pour les sources des scripts shell, je doit les avoir sur un hd de backup chez moi smile.gif
Florian_
Citation
N'hésites pas à venir nous montrer tes sources Florian smile.gif

je suis curieux de voir à quoi peut ressembler un machin de ce genre.


D'accord voici un petit exemple que j'avais fait il y a assez longtemps qui ajoute un utilisateur FTP sur le logiciel Windows Typsoft FTP Server je crois ^^

Code
<?php
if($_POST['confirm_pass']=='azerty'){
$conf = fopen('C:\TYPSoft FTP Server\users.ini', 'a');
$login = $_POST['login_ftp'];
$password = md5($_POST['pass_ftp']);
mkdir('C:'."\\".'account'."\\".''.$login.''."\\".'');
mkdir('C:'."\\".'account'."\\".''.$login.''."\\".'www');
mkdir('C:'."\\".'account'."\\".''.$login.''."\\".'logs');
$dir0 = 'C:'."\\".'account'."\\".''.$login.''."\\".'|DU_EMRY_S__|';
$path = 'C:'."\\".'account'."\\".''.$login.''."\\".'';
feof($conf);
fputs($conf, "
[$login]
Password=".strtoupper("$password")."
UserDisable=0
VirtualDir=1
Time-Out=0
MaxSpeed=0
MaxUser=0
MaxUserIP=0
EnterMessage=Bienvenue $login sur votre FTP
ExitMessage=
HomePath=$path
Dir0=$dir0
TotalDownload=0
TotalUpload=0");
fclose($conf);
$alire = fopen("C:/account/$login/ALIRE.txt","w");
fwrite($alire,"Merci de NE PAS supprimer le dossiers logs et www, tous vos fichiers se placent dans le dossier www");
fclose($alire);
echo '<br><br><b>Le compte FTP '.$login.' à bien été créer</b><br><br>';
}
else {
    echo '<form action="" method="POST"><b>Aucune vérification</b><br><br>
    Ajouter un utilisateur :<br>
    Login FTP : <input type="text" name="login_ftp"> (CHIFFRES OU/ET LETTRES SANS ESPACE ! (et au moins trois caracteres !) (ya pas de vérif !!!) )<br>
    Pass FTP : <input type="text" name="pass_ftp">  (meme chose que login!)(pas de verif!)<br>
    <br>
    <b>Le script va créer le dossier compte + www + logs </b><br><br><br>
    Mot de passe de securite : <input type="text" name="confirm_pass"><br>
    <input type="submit" value="Je viens de verifier et jenvoie !">
    </form>';
}
?>


J'avais codé ça à l'arrache ^^

++
TitaX
Sinon ISPCONFIG existe aussi
Nokilling
Tien pour ceux que sa intéresse, là c'est un script KSH pour ajouter un utilisateur ftp avec MySecureShell :
Code
#!/bin/ksh
# Script shell pour ajouter un utilisateur MySecureShell
# Paramêtres :
#    - $1 : nom de l'utilisateur MySecureShell
#    - $2 : password crypte de l'utilisateur MySecureShell
#### Creation du dossier de l'utilisateur chroot ####
mkdir /var/www/htdocs/users/$1
#### Mettre les droits de lecture/execution a l'utilisateur chroote ####
chmod 755 /var/www/htdocs/users/$1
#### Affectation a la variable $cryptpw du password crypte de l'utilisateur ####
cryptpw=$(userdbpw -md5 <<InputPass
$2
$2
InputPass)
#### Ajout de l'utilisateur avec le shell MySecureShell le group vftp et le password crypte $2 ####
useradd -m -s /bin/MySecureShell -g vftp -p $cryptpw $1
#### Changer le proprietaire du fichier ####
chown $1 /var/www/htdocs/users/$1
#### Changer le groupe du fichier ####
chgrp vftp /var/www/htdocs/users/$1


Après le code PHP il est pas dur, suffit d'utiliser la commande system (ou encore exec) smile.gif
Florian_
Citation (TitaX @ 8 Jul 2008, 23:29) *
Sinon ISPCONFIG existe aussi


J'ai testé ISPCONFIG et je n'aime pas trop trop je préfère largement vhcs ^^
Ceci est une version "bas débit" de notre forum. Pour voir la version complète avec plus d'informations, la mise en page et les images, veuillez cliquer ici.
Invision Power Board © 2001-2009 Invision Power Services, Inc.